TMS320F2833x与TMS320F2823x DSC信号控制及接口规范

需积分: 49 84 下载量 136 浏览量 更新于2024-08-08 收藏 2.3MB PDF 举报
该资源是一份关于微服务架构的基础教程,涵盖了Spring Boot、Spring Cloud和Docker的相关知识。教程可能涉及如何使用这些技术构建、部署和管理分布式系统。 【Spring Boot知识点】 Spring Boot简化了Java应用的初始设置,通过默认配置、起步依赖和命令行界面,使得开发人员可以快速创建独立运行的Spring应用程序。它强调“约定优于配置”,减少了项目配置的工作量。 - **起步依赖**:Spring Boot通过起步依赖管理项目所需的各种库,例如数据库连接、Web服务等,避免了手动添加多个依赖的问题。 - **自动配置**:Spring Boot根据项目中的jar依赖自动配置相关的Spring Bean,减少了大量手动配置。 - **内嵌式Web服务器**:如Tomcat或Jetty,允许开发者快速启动并测试Web应用。 【Spring Cloud知识点】 Spring Cloud为开发人员提供了快速构建分布式系统的一些工具,如服务发现、配置中心、断路器、智能路由、微代理、控制总线等。 - **服务发现**:如Eureka,用于注册和发现服务,实现服务间的互相通信。 - **配置管理**:Spring Cloud Config提供集中式的配置服务,便于动态更新应用配置。 - **熔断机制**:Hystrix实现服务降级、熔断和隔离,防止故障扩散。 - **负载均衡**:Ribbon是客户端的负载均衡器,与Eureka结合可以实现服务间的负载均衡。 【Docker知识点】 Docker是一种开源的应用容器引擎,基于Go语言并遵循Apache2.0协议开源。Docker让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的Linux机器上,也可以实现虚拟化。 - **容器化**:Docker容器轻量级且独立,能运行在单个或集群主机上,互不影响。 - **镜像**:Docker镜像是创建容器的基础,包含了运行应用所需的所有依赖和环境。 - **Dockerfile**:用于构建Docker镜像的文本文件,包含了构建过程的指令。 - **Docker Compose**:用于定义和运行多容器Docker应用的工具,简化了微服务的部署。 此外,资源中提及的延迟时间和时序要求属于嵌入式系统或DSP(数字信号处理器)领域的知识,特别是TMS320F28335等型号的DSP芯片的电气规范,涉及到数据传输和接口同步的精确时序。这部分内容对于理解如何正确与这类处理器进行通信至关重要,但与微服务架构的主题不太相关。在微服务架构中,通常关注的是软件层面的服务交互,而非硬件层面的时序问题。